Transaction 80609494f97039c28b8be88af829eb9d79df23ad67989e0c0ef611601edf9890

1 Input
2 Outputs
  • 80609494f97039c28b8be88af829eb9d79df23ad67989e0c0ef611601edf9890:0
  • value  16500465
    address  2N3Zw4dZGEzK8tLxaNkMgTji875yU1FY6nT
  • 80609494f97039c28b8be88af829eb9d79df23ad67989e0c0ef611601edf9890:1
  • value  85324783191
    address  2NAgmevaipKxEFKPCEQuT38KpZEDQSoidWh